Genesis 27:6-15
English Standard Version
Chapter 27
6
Rebekah said to her son Jacob, "I heard your father speak to your brother Esau,
7
‘Bring me game and prepare for me delicious food, that I may eat it and bless you before the
Lord
before I die.’
8
Now therefore, my son, obey my voice as I command you.
9
Go to the flock and bring me two good young goats, so that I may prepare from them delicious food for your father, such as he loves.
10
And you shall bring it to your father to eat, so that he may bless you before he dies."
11
But Jacob said to Rebekah his mother, "Behold, my brother Esau is a hairy man, and I am a smooth man.
12
Perhaps my father will feel me, and I shall seem to be mocking him and bring a curse upon myself and not a blessing."
13
His mother said to him, "Let your curse be on me, my son; only obey my voice, and go, bring them to me."
14
So he went and took them and brought them to his mother, and his mother prepared delicious food, such as his father loved.
15
Then Rebekah took the best garments of Esau her older son, which were with her in the house, and put them on Jacob her younger son.
